When teaching ham radio license classes, I often get asked whether the FCC enforces the Part 97 rules and regulations. That is, how likely is it that the FCC would come after me if I violate the rules? This same question surfaces concerning the General Mobile Radio Service (GMRS).

This morning, I looked at the FCC Enforcement Actions page, to see what’s there. First off, there are a ton of actions against unlicensed FM broadcast stations, in response to the PIRATE Act pass by Congress in 2020. There are also many actions against people operating RoboCall systems via telephone. If you find yourself bored, go ahead and read through these enforcement actions.

Here are some actions taken by the FCC concerning Amateur Radio and GMRS in the past few years:

In June 2022, the FCC sent a Notice of Violation to David Dean, K0PWO, concerning a continuous carrier signal on 7.033 MHz from a remote station near Fairplay, Colorado. I recall there being a ruckus about this incident in the ham radio community but I did not know it resulted in a Notice of Violation.

In June 2022, the FCC issued a Notice of Apparent Liability (FCC talk for “we are fining you”) of $34k to Jason Frawley, WA7CQ. The FCC says that Frawley used his ham radio to transmit on frequencies allocated and authorized for government use during the Johnson wildfire near Elk River, Idaho.

In November 2022, the FCC sent a Notice of Violation to David Dean, K0PWO. (This is the same person with the stuck transmitter in June 2022.) The FCC received a complaint from the State of Colorado that someone (later found to be Dean) had an illegally cloned radio transmitting on the State’s digital trunked radio system (DTRS) without authorization.

In June 2023, the FCC issued a Notice of Violation to Martin Anderson, GMRS WQQP653 in Vancouver, WA. This relates to a stuck transmitter, apparently due to a faulty transceiver at a repeater site. It transmitted continuous, unmodulated signals on the frequency of 462.725 MHz.

In August 2023, the FCC issued a Notice of Violation to Jonathan Gutierrez, GMRS license WRTD259 in response to a complaint of intentional interference to a 462.625 MHz repeater in Mt. Holly, Pennsylvania.

In August 2023, the FCC issued a Notice of Violation to Alarm Detection Systems, licensee of radio station WQSK406 in Louisville, Colorado. This is not ham or GMRS-related but involves a business band radio on 460 MHz. Apparently, the company continued to operate legacy “wideband” FM radios after the FCC required business band radio users to switch to “narrowband” radios (12.5 kHz channels). I found this interesting because it is an action related to the use of improper radio gear and emission type.

In May 2024, the FCC issued a Notice of Unlicensed Operation to Skydive Elsinore, LLC, a skydiving company in Lake Elsinore, CA. This company was transmitting in the 70 cm amateur band on 442.725 MHz without a proper license.

From these notices, we can see that the FCC does enforce amateur and GMRS rules, but not as often as we’d like to see. Usually, the situation has to be a big nuisance before it escalates enough for the FCC to take action. If you make a simple mistake once or twice, you are highly unlikely to be cited. If you are a more consistent or flagrant rule breaker, then you might get a visit from the FCC.

Remember that the ARRL has the Volunteer Monitor program, operating under a formal agreement with the FCC,  that can assist with on-the-air violations.

73 Bob K0NR

The Colorado Search and Rescue Association is promoting FRS (Family Radio Service) Channel 3 as “the default during backcountry search and rescue (backcountry SAR) emergencies.” FRS channel 3 is the same as GMRS (General Mobile Radio Service) channel 3. There is more GMRS info here. To keep things simple, no CTCSS (“privacy code”) is used…carrier squelch only.  See the CSAR announcement here: FRS Radio Use for Backcountry.

For backcountry exploring, it is important to emphasize self-sufficiency and to avoid reliance on electronic gizmos that may fail. Avoiding an emergency situation is way better than having a device to call for help, which may be many hours away. See this article for a discussion of The Ten Essentials for Hiking.

Still, the FRS3 concept has merit. Many backcountry hikers already carry FRS or GMRS radios, so designating a preferred channel makes sense. My read on this is that randomly calling for help on FRS3 will not be very effective due to the limited range of FRS radios. However, it does not hurt to try. More likely, FRS3 can be used for local comms once Search and Rescue crews have been deployed and are within a few miles of the party in distress.

Ham radio operators may want to carry a handheld transceiver capable of transmitting on 462.6125 MHz. For emergency use only, of course.

Today’s OnAllBands product spotlight shines a bright light on Alinco’s new GMRS handheld transceiver. But before we get into the benefits and features of the DJ-G46T model, let’s take a moment to discuss GMRS and how it differs from the Family Radio Service (FRS).

What is GMRS?

GMRS stands for General Mobile Radio Service—a licensed radio service that uses channels around 462 MHz and 467 MHz. From the Federal Communications Commission’s (FCC) website:

“The most common use of GMRS channels is for short-distance, two-way voice communications using handheld radios, mobile radios, and repeater systems. In 2017, the FCC expanded GMRS to also allow short data messaging applications including text messaging and GPS location information.

“The GMRS is available to an individual for short-distance two-way communications to facilitate the activities of licensees and their immediate family members. Each licensee manages a system consisting of one or more transmitting units (stations).”

An FCC license is required to operate a GMRS system, but unlike obtaining a ham radio license, no exam is required. In 2017, the FCC increased the license term from five to ten years. You may apply for a GMRS license if you are 18 years or older. If you receive a license, any family member, regardless of age, can operate GMRS stations and units within the licensed system.

Find FCC service rules for the GMRS here.

What is the FRS?

Per the FCC, the Family Radio Service is a private, two-way short-distance voice and data communications service for facilitating family and group activities. The most common use for FRS channels is short-distance, two-way voice communications using small handheld radios that are similar to walkie-talkies. An individual license is not required to operate an FRS radio provided you comply with the rules. You may operate an FRS radio regardless of your age, and for personal or business use. Channel sharing is achieved through a listen-before-talk etiquette.

The FRS has an authorized 22 channels in the 462 MHz and 467 MHz range, all of which are shared with GMRS. Each channel has a bandwidth of 12.5 kHz; power of each channel is either 0.5W or 2W.

There are almost as many GMRS licenses as Techs…

By: k4fmh
11 February 2023 at 22:23

At a recent local hamfest, my ARRL Section Manager, Malcolm W5XX, held the annual ARRL Forum. As Division Director David Norris K5UZ was giving his update on the recent Board of Directors meeting. W5XX commented that a club in North Georgia had begun reaching out to licensees of the General Mobile Radio Service (GMRS). Why? There are some 8,000 of them in surrounding counties! Give a statistician a number like that and it’s catnip to a cat.

I had heard of GMRS and the lighter-weight Family Radio Service (FRS) as additional radio frequencies to the famous Citizen’s Band (CB) that I used as a teen. But I didn’t really know much about it. So, I spent parts of a week doing some searching, reading, and, inevitably, database building. I saw the wisdom of the club in question reaching out to this audience. Let’s do a thought experiment to flesh this out.

GMRS licensees use radios up to 50 watts on mobile stations and 15 watts in fixed stations in the mid-400 mhz region. There are limitations on the type of one-way communications (no whistling which would rule out most anyone in amateur radio tuning up an amplifier, lol). But in general, there are parallels to GMRS operators to those holding a Technician license in the Amateur Radio Service with the latter having much greater frequency access, power usage, and other aspects of the radio arts.

The General Mobile Radio Service (GMRS) is a licensed radio service that uses channels around 462 MHz and 467 MHz. The most common use of GMRS channels is for short-distance, two-way voice communications using hand-held radios, mobile radios and repeater systems. In 2017, the FCC expanded GMRS to also allow short data messaging applications including text messaging and GPS location information.

After doing some reading, I checked the FCC ULS GMRS license data. There’s an interesting comparison: the ARRL February 2023 numbers show 386,122 Technicians while individual GMRS licenses total 336, 513 after APO addresses and one Canadian are removed. Organizations and some other groups can obtain GMRS licenses. Roughly, there are about as many individual GMRS licensees as there are Technicians, give or take 50,000. Ok, I thought, this is surprising but how do they operate? Are they communicating amongst themselves as ham operators do? How many GMRS repeaters are there? The surprises just kept on coming!

The popular site, RepeaterBook.com, does list some GMRS repeaters. But the mother ship is the myGMRS.com website. One has to have a GMRS license to register but there’s enough information available to the public to show just how organized parts of the GMRS community already is. I’ve taken a screenshot of the map display, nicely done with clustering repeaters until a certain zoom level is reached, showing the GMRS repeaters in the U.S. Note those in Puerto Rico: I had recommended that the ARRL assist in getting a permanent repeater on the westernmost mountains near Mayaguez after a devastating hurricane. Perhaps even an HF ALE type station directed at Florida or North Carolina. Looks like the GMRS community has done some work here, too.

The map below illustrates the set of repeater hubs and their links around the U.S. There are national and regional Nets held regularly. An audio stream can be monitored using the website for each hub, not unlike Hoseline for the Brandmeister DMR Network. Hmm. If ham radio were only this organized, so quickly.

Linked Repeaters from the myGMRS.com website illustrating hubs and links around the U.S.

After downloading the February 2023 GMRS data from the FCC ULS ftp site, I processed it and filtered out the overseas military licenses. These records were then georeferenced to street addresses, with some that did not have street addresses geocoded to zip codes and a few to city centroids. The map below illustrates this: the GMRS individual license IS a compelling market for amateur radio recruitment.

It’s easy to see that the North Georgia region is part of the Appalachian Mountain range that is covered with GMRS licensees But so is most of the region east of the Mississippi River, the West Coast and the mountainous areas of the Southwest. Here’s another view zoomed in to the ARRL Delta Division where I live. Licensees in GMRS tend to follow population centers but note the areas, like Nashville, where the topography gives more height-above-ground than others. Northwest Arkansas is another such location. Interesting patterns!

We know little to nothing about the age distribution of GMRS licensees as year of birth is not contained in the ULS database released to the public (only 18 or over). But it stands to reason that GMRS licensees are likely to have a broader age range of adoption. From perusing the names on the licenses — license holders can authorize other family members to use additional radios in this Service — there are gendered-naming patterns. More women in GMRS than ham radio? Possibly.

Some interactive maps of these data are now available over at FoxMikeHotel.com under the Maps tab.

An important note is that an unknown number of those holding GMRS licenses today also hold licenses in the Amateur Radio Service. The FRN is not contained in the GMRS data so it would take “fuzzy matching” with less than perfect results to examine this idea.

Should the GMRS licensees be viewed as another direct marketing opportunity by the ARRL?

Only if they are serious about wanting to grow the ranks of amateur radio…

The ARRL has taken an interest in my proposed initiative to treat public libraries in the U.S. as “new served agencies” for recruitment strategies, according to Division Director David Norris K5UZ. See my two blog posts here and here. Should the GMRS licensees be viewed as another direct marketing opportunity by the ARRL?

I’ve taken the GMRS data and spatially joined the ARRL Division and Section fields to the license record using GIS. These files were then split into separate spreadsheets by Division with the Section as a separate field. I’ve put them on my public folder in Dropbox for all to retrieve should they desire. This would make it easy for a direct-mailing to GMRS licensees. In a cover letter identifying the contact info for their ARRL Section Manager, a brochure should be inserted describing the much greater options available by adding the Technician license through a VE exam. It works for some yield rates for other membership services. (Check today’s mail if you doubt this isn’t used frequently.)

Click HERE for the Dropbox folder.

It would not be inexpensive with USPS rates. But it would be directed at a market that is already known to have some interested in operating radios for communication. Perhaps it should begin with GMRS licensees in areas where there are existing repeater operations. This would be a good test case to see the yield from such a direct mailing.

What won’t work is to simply send the information “down stream,” expecting SMs to do all the heavy lifting. It simply won’t happen. The League already conducts a commercial mailing operation which is where this activity should be situated.

This would be a third recruiting rail for the ARRL, including the Teacher Institute (getting in schools), the pending (I’m told) Plant the Seed initiative for public libraries, and the direct mailing to known radio communication licensees in the GMRS arena. Recruit the Generals, anyone?
